Scheduling of real time tasks on clouds is one of the research problem, Where the matching of machines and completion time of the tasks are considered. Cloud computing is an internet-based computing, where resources, softwares and information are shared on demand basis i.e. The user can access documents anytime, anywhere. Real-time computer systems are required to produce correct results not only in their values but also in the times at which the results are produced known as timeliness. Here a quantitative expression of time is used to describe the behavior of the system. Real-time task...
Scheduling of real time tasks on clouds is one of the research problem, Where the matching of machines and completion time of the tasks are considered...
The SaaS deployment is the installation to delivery of software services in cloud computing infrastructure. SaaS deployment is initiated by a cloud service provider via a user requesting process, which is generally automated. SaaS is a combination of different type of components; application component, integration component, business component, and storage component. Component placement problem (CPP) concerns with finding the optimum set of VMs on which SaaS components can be placed such that all user requirements should be satisfied and maximizes the profit of the SaaS...
The SaaS deployment is the installation to delivery of software services in cloud computing infrastructure. SaaS deployment is initiated by a cloud se...
These heuristic algorithms operate in two phases, selection of task from the task pool, followed by selection of cloud resource. A set of ten greedy heuristics for resource allocation using the greedy paradigm has been used, that operates in two stages. At each stage a particular input is selected through a selection procedure. Then a decision is made regarding the selected input, whether to include it into the partially constructed optimal solution. The selection procedure can be realized using a 2-phase heuristic. In particular, we have used 'FcfsRand', 'FcfsRr', 'FcfsMin', 'FcfsMax',...
These heuristic algorithms operate in two phases, selection of task from the task pool, followed by selection of cloud resource. A set of ten greedy h...
Cloud computing is an encouraging and favorable paradigm for both providers and consumers in diverse scopes of endeavors. Software as a Service (SaaS) is a method of conveying services or applications through the Internet as a service, and it is known to be one of the very crucial computing services in cloud computing. Cloud computing has become a major medium for the SaaS providers to provide their applications so as to meet required scalability. The challenges of SaaS placement process depends on various factors comprising cloud network size, resource requirements, and communication among...
Cloud computing is an encouraging and favorable paradigm for both providers and consumers in diverse scopes of endeavors. Software as a Service (SaaS)...